Dialogue between whom? The role of the west/non-west distinction in promoting global dialogue in IR

Hutchings, K. (2011). Dialogue between whom? The role of the west/non-west distinction in promoting global dialogue in IR. Millennium: Journal of International Studies, 39(3), 639-647. https://doi.org/10.1177/0305829811401941
Copy

There is a politics to the West/non-West distinction that is bound up with predominant models for dialogue in IR; rethinking these models of dialogue implies a new politics, and therefore also, I will suggest, a move away from the West/non-West binary as a way of characterising the participants in dialogic exchange oriented towards the expansive transformation of disciplinary imaginaries.
